package helpers
import (
"testing"
"github.com/RedHatInsights/insights-operator-utils/tests/helpers"
"github.com/RedHatInsights/insights-results-aggregator/server"
"github.com/RedHatInsights/insights-results-aggregator/storage"
)
// APIRequest is a type for APIRequest
type APIRequest = helpers.APIRequest
// APIResponse is a type for APIResponse
type APIResponse = helpers.APIResponse
var (
// ExecuteRequest executes request
ExecuteRequest = helpers.ExecuteRequest
// CheckResponseBodyJSON checks response body
CheckResponseBodyJSON = helpers.CheckResponseBodyJSON
// AssertReportResponsesEqual fails if report responses aren't equal
AssertReportResponsesEqual = helpers.AssertReportResponsesEqual
// AssertReportResponsesEqualCustomElementsChecker fails if report responses aren't equal
AssertReportResponsesEqualCustomElementsChecker = helpers.AssertReportResponsesEqualCustomElementsChecker
// AssertRuleResponsesEqual fails if rule responses aren't equal
AssertRuleResponsesEqual = helpers.AssertRuleResponsesEqual
// NewGockRequestMatcher returns a new matcher for github.com/h2non/gock to match requests
// with provided method, url and jsonBody
NewGockRequestMatcher = helpers.NewGockRequestMatcher
// GockExpectAPIRequest makes gock expect the request with the baseURL and sends back the response
GockExpectAPIRequest = helpers.GockExpectAPIRequest
// MakeXRHTokenString converts types.Token to a token string(base64 encoded)
MakeXRHTokenString = helpers.MakeXRHTokenString
)
// DefaultServerConfig is a default config used by AssertAPIRequest
var DefaultServerConfig = server.Configuration{
Address: ":8080",
APIPrefix: "/api/test/",
APISpecFile: "openapi.json",
Debug: true,
Auth: false,
MaximumFeedbackMessageLength: 255,
OrgOverviewLimitHours: 2,
}
// DefaultServerConfigAuth is a default config used by AssertAPIRequest with authentication set to true
var DefaultServerConfigAuth = server.Configuration{
Address: ":8080",
APIPrefix: "/api/test/",
APISpecFile: "openapi.json",
Debug: true,
Auth: true,
AuthType: "xrh",
MaximumFeedbackMessageLength: 255,
OrgOverviewLimitHours: 2,
}
// AssertAPIRequest creates new server with provided mockStorage
// (which you can keep nil so it will be created automatically)
// and provided serverConfig(you can leave it empty to use the default one)
// sends api request and checks api response (see docs for APIRequest and APIResponse)
func AssertAPIRequest(
t testing.TB,
mockStorage storage.OCPRecommendationsStorage,
serverConfig *server.Configuration,
request *helpers.APIRequest,
expectedResponse *helpers.APIResponse,
) {
if mockStorage == nil {
var closer func()
mockStorage, closer = MustGetPostgresStorage(t, true)
defer closer()
}
if serverConfig == nil {
serverConfig = &DefaultServerConfig
}
testServer := server.New(*serverConfig, mockStorage, nil)
helpers.AssertAPIRequest(t, testServer, serverConfig.APIPrefix, request, expectedResponse)
}
